I just installed XP Fax recently but am trying to fax an attachment
that I scanned into the computer. Some are TIF's and some are PDF's.
Can this be done without outlook or office being installed? I noticed
that the fax wizard does not have the ability to attach a file to a
fax, is there anyway to do this?

As long as you have an application that can print a file, you should be able
to fax by printing to the Fax Printer, which should appear in your list of
printers.

Faxing attachments requires the use of Outlook. Otherwise you must print to
fax from the originating application.
